    This week on Off The Menu, we leave the kitchen and step into the garden with Roy Adams — the Deathwish Beekeeper, a fearless local legend who proves that real community isn’t just built at the table — it starts in the fields, the flowers, and the hive.

    We explore how beekeeping reflects the power of small connections: between people, nature, and the food we share. From the hive to the jar, honey is a living reminder that our best things come from working together. Roy shares how caring for bees builds patience, trust, and stewardship — and how local food traditions keep communities thriving.

    Grab a cup of tea (with a little honey, of course) and join us for a conversation that’s as sweet as it is thought-provoking.

    What makes a neighborhood coffee shop more than just a place to grab a cup of coffee? In our first episode of The Off The Menu, we sit down with Colin Gawel, owner of Colin’s Coffee, to talk about how a simple shop can become the heartbeat of a community. From familiar faces to first-time visitors, it’s a story about connection, conversation, and why it’s never just about what’s in the cup—it’s about who’s across the table.
